Kenneth Spry Obituary

OXFORD — Kenneth Earl Spry, who was born in Bridgeport, found peace and joined the Heavenly Father on November 24, 2021. Ken is survived by his loving wife of 59 years, Madeline; daughter, Brenda Marie Spry; son, Kenneth Earl Spry and his partner, Christine Louise Taylor; grandson, Andrew Kenneth Spry; granddaughter, Taya Rose Cardella; great-grandson, Luca Antinino Barbagallo, and the family pet, Jet. He is also survived by his brother, Raymond Spry and sister, Kathleen Howell, and many nieces and nephews. He is joined in Heaven by his mother, Marion Spry; brother, James Spry, and sister, Jean Olender. Ken had proudly served in the United States Navy as a boatswain’s mate from January 18, 1955, to January 14, 1959. He served on the USS Decatur (DD936) and the Valley Forge (CVS 45). He was a devoted and compassionate husband, father and Papa. He was a true family man and always put his wife and family first. He always had a calm way and was a true pillar of strength to his entire family. Ken could fix most anything and was affectionately called “our MacGyver.” He loved to laugh and joke and maybe pull a prank or two. Ken enjoyed Sunday dinners with the family, movie nights with his grandson, the outdoors, walking in the woods, fishing, hunting, working in his yard and garden. He enjoyed working with wood, finishes and paints. He enjoyed his coffee, Honey Nut Cheerios, omelets, potato pancakes (a specialty he made) and a good hot dog. Ken enjoyed following news and world affairs as well as westerns and the History Channel. Ken was loved and respected and will be greatly missed.
